作为一名程序员,在使用VS代码进行多人协作开发时,代码冲突是不可避免的。这些冲突可能会导致代码库的不一致,影响项目的正常进行。下面,我将为大家分享5大实用技巧,帮助大家轻松解决VS代码冲突。
技巧一:使用Git命令行解决冲突
在VS代码中,我们可以通过Git命令行来查看和解决冲突。以下是一个简单的步骤:
- 打开VS代码的Git命令行,输入以下命令查看冲突文件:
git status - 找到冲突文件,打开该文件,你会看到冲突标记(如
<<<<<<<,=======,>>>>>>>)。 - 修改冲突内容,使其符合你的需求。
- 将修改后的文件添加到暂存区:
git add 文件名 - 提交修改:
git commit -m "解决冲突"
技巧二:使用VS代码内置的合并工具
VS代码内置了一个合并工具,可以帮助我们更方便地解决冲突。以下是使用方法:
- 打开冲突文件,点击工具栏上的“Merge”按钮。
- 在弹出的合并窗口中,选择“Three-way merge”模式。
- 仔细阅读冲突内容,并进行修改。
- 点击“Save”保存修改,然后提交。
技巧三:利用外部合并工具
如果你更喜欢使用外部合并工具,如Beyond Compare、GitKraken等,可以按照以下步骤操作:
- 打开冲突文件,选择你喜欢的合并工具。
- 根据合并工具的提示,解决冲突。
- 将修改后的文件保存,并提交。
技巧四:使用Git分支管理
在多人协作开发中,合理地使用Git分支可以降低冲突的发生概率。以下是一些建议:
- 为每个功能创建独立的分支,避免直接在主分支上进行修改。
- 在合并分支前,先解决所有冲突。
- 合并分支时,尽量使用“Fast-forward”模式,避免冲突。
技巧五:加强团队沟通
在多人协作开发中,加强团队沟通是解决冲突的关键。以下是一些建议:
- 定期召开团队会议,讨论项目进度和可能出现的问题。
- 及时反馈问题,共同寻找解决方案。
- 尊重他人意见,共同推进项目进度。
通过以上5大实用技巧,相信大家能够轻松解决VS代码冲突,提高开发效率。祝大家工作顺利!
